Polygamy showdown: balancing child welfare, religious freedom
By Charles C. Haynes Religious freedom ends where child abuse begins, but Texas officials face tricky task in determining whether abuse occurred; outcome could create new grounds for government intervention in religious groups. 04.27.08
 
10th Circuit says Wyo. man must stand trial in eagle case
Unanimous three-judge panel finds that Native Americans' religious freedoms aren't violated by federal law protecting birds or government's permit policy. 05.09.08
